Linux ошибка удаления файла

Произошла ошибка при удалении. (не могу удалить файлы и папки на ntfs)

Всем привет.
Когда Windows перезагружался, он решил установить массу обновлений.
Я не мог ждать, очень сильно был нужен Linux, выключил посреди обновления.
После этого что-то с файловой системой случилось.
В конце концов всё-равно переустанавливаю Windows.

(Удаляю из Ubuntы)
При удалении Windows/SoftwareDistribution:
Произошла ошибка при удалении.
Не удалось удалить папку amd64_microsoft-windows. 10_none_67770e0aae6a7c68.
Произошла ошибка при удалении файла: Каталог не пуст

При удалении Windows/winsxs:
Произошла ошибка при удалении.
Произошла ошибка при получении сведений о файлах в папке «b93979e36bf69a9dc5964746ed3a3765».
Произошла ошибка при получении сведений о файле «/media/windows/Windows/SoftwareDistribution/Download/b93979e36bf69a9dc5964746ed3a3765/x86_microsoft-windows-mobsyncexe_31bf3856ad364e35_6.1.7601.17514_none_f1584379b2973708»: Ошибка ввода/вывода

Форматировать раздел не хочу так как там есть некоторые полезные данные.
Хотя конечно если нет другого варианта можно перенести файлы, форматировать и перенести обратно.

А ежели ntfsfix на раздел натравить?

«/media/windows/Windows/SoftwareDistribution/Download/b93979e36bf69a9dc5964746e d3a3765/x86_microsoft-windows-mobsyncexe_31bf3856ad364e35_6.1.7601.17514_none_f1 584379b2973708»

что-то про 255 символов ограничение на ntfs помоему было

sudo ntfsfix /dev/sda3
Mounting volume. OK
Processing of $MFT and $MFTMirr completed successfully.
NTFS volume version is 3.1.
NTFS partition /dev/sda3 was processed successfully.

rm -r winsxs
rm: невозможно удалить «winsxs/amd64_microsoft-windows-minkernelapinamespace_31bf3856ad364e35_6.1.7600.16850_none_66c2596d956d1920»: Каталог не пуст
rm: невозможно удалить «winsxs/amd64_microsoft-windows-minkernelapinamespace_31bf3856ad364e35_6.1.7600.21010_none_67770e0aae6a7c68»: Каталог не пуст
rm: невозможно удалить «winsxs/amd64_microsoft-windows-minkernelapinamespace_31bf3856ad364e35_6.1.7601.17651_none_68a9b6bd92929e63»: Каталог не пуст
rm: невозможно удалить «winsxs/amd64_microsoft-windows-minkernelapinamespace_31bf3856ad364e35_6.1.7601.21772_none_691eb3faabbf8f66»: Каталог не пуст

rm -r SoftwareDistribution
.
rm: невозможно удалить «SoftwareDistribution/Download/b93979e36bf69a9dc5964746ed3a3765/amd64_microsoft-windows-mail-comm-dll_31bf3856ad364e35_6.1.7601.17514_none_d7d72fd96f2c2eaa»: Нет такого файла или каталога
rm: невозможно удалить «SoftwareDistribution/Download/b93979e36bf69a9dc5964746ed3a3765/amd64_microsoft-windows-main_31bf3856ad364e35_6.1.7601.17514_none_062284e03286a56a.manifest»: Нет такого файла или каталога
rm: невозможно удалить «SoftwareDistribution/Download/b93979e36bf69a9dc5964746ed3a3765/amd64_microsoft-windows-mediaplayer-autoplay_31bf3856ad364e35_6.1.7601.17514_none_7920b60d569a4a1e»: Нет такого файла или каталога
rm: невозможно удалить «SoftwareDistribution/Download/b93979e36bf69a9dc5964746ed3a3765/amd64_microsoft-windows-mediaplayer-core_31bf3856ad364e35_6.1.7601.17514_none_698fc88e65b943d6.manifest»: Нет такого файла или каталога
rm: невозможно удалить «SoftwareDistribution/Download/b93979e36bf69a9dc5964746ed3a3765/amd64_microsoft-windows-mediaplayer-drm_31bf3856ad364e35_6.1.7601.17514_none_cc5420b1db6c788a»: Каталог не пуст
.

Читайте также:  Команды линукс в python

palimpsest(Дисковая утилита) При проверке говорит что всё нормально
GParted использовал для проверки «ntfsresize -P -i -f -v /dev/sda3». Вывел тоже список ошибок.
Какой сказать сейчас не могу, проблемы с отмонтированием /dev/sda3

А систему нельзя заставить просто удалить упоминания об этих папках из таблицы разделов.
Или там всё сильно друг на друге завязано.

P.S.: Насколько сильно windows сам себя испортил.
А если компьютер питается от сети, электричество отключат, а Windows устанавливает обновления. тот-же результат наверно будет.

Источник

unixforum.org

Не могу удалить файл (Linux говорит что файл не существует)

Не могу удалить файл

А еще такой вопрос — не могу удалить файл. Система просто отрицает его существование. Пробовал удалять через root в консоли — не могу, файл не существует, хотя вечно висит в окошке. Сегодня у меня таких файлов стало 2, причем второй на рабочем столе. А теперь подробности: у меня Сюся 10.3 KDE 3.5.7. а файлики появились после неаккуратно прерванных программ (Ctrl_Alt_Esc). Помогите пожалуста избавится, а то не красиво на рабочем столе файл глаза мозолит. Спасибо!

Re: Не могу удалить файл

vasilbelarus
Попробуйте на файловую систему fsck натравить. http://ru.wikipedia.org/wiki/Fsck
Только man внимательно прочитайте.

Re: Не могу удалить файл

Сообщение Burnout » 11.04.2008 23:35

Re: Не могу удалить файл

Спасибо! Попробовал — ничего не изменилось, хотя fsck и исправил какие-то ошибки. Файл с рабочего стола удалось удалить командой rm -f в руте, а другой такой файл всетаки не удаляется. Возможно это связанно с его страшным названием «??s. Ǩt?dc=. O~?z. K~. 岴??LO. i<. N??V. Ra?LX+l. 7. W. ⵞ?4?Zn7. x. " Переименоваться и перемещаться файл не хочет - он ведь не существует.

Re: Не могу удалить файл

xnu!l Сообщения: 632 Статус: Linux Gangster 4 Life ОС: openSUSE 11

Re: Не могу удалить файл

Сообщение xnu!l » 13.04.2008 03:44

Спасибо! Попробовал — ничего не изменилось, хотя fsck и исправил какие-то ошибки. Файл с рабочего стола удалось удалить командой rm -f в руте, а другой такой файл всетаки не удаляется. Возможно это связанно с его страшным названием «??s. Ǩt?dc=. O~?z. K~. 岴??LO. i<. N??V. Ra?LX+l. 7. W. ⵞ?4?Zn7. x. " Переименоваться и перемещаться файл не хочет - он ведь не существует.

Читайте также:  What is compatibility mode linux mint

Re: Не могу удалить файл

Сообщение stomp » 13.04.2008 09:22

Re: Не могу удалить файл

http://www.cyberciti.biz/tips/delete-remov. ode-number.html
[quote]
Попробовал ссылочку — в результате снова No such file or directory. Хотя через dir — файлик высвечивается и через ls -il его и-нод номер определяется.

Re: Не могу удалить файл

Сообщение stomp » 15.04.2008 19:26

Re: Не могу удалить файл

Сообщение Valeriy » 16.04.2008 00:23

Блин, 700Мб.
Все тоже самое и гораздо меньше — Puppy Linux (есть и русская версия PuppyRus) — эти чуть больше 100Мб. Так называемая, Puppy fat-free — 60Мб. Еще одна система — DSL, тоже мелкая — 60Мб.
Советую PuppyRus, так как нравится и с русским все ОК (в том числе и на NTFS разделах).

Re: Не могу удалить файл

Re: Не могу удалить файл

Привет Ребята. Я наконец-то удалил свой файлик. Совет всем у кого похожая проблема
(В скобках содержится информация для новичков):
Заходите в faillsafe (выбирается при загрузке, введите при запросе root , затем свой пароль. Внимание! Введение пароля может не сопроваждаться появлением звездочек, поэтому после того как набрали пароль жмите ввод.)
Заходите в каталог в котором лежит файл (команда cd /ваш каталог)
Вводите команду ls -il (Появится список всех файлов вашего каталога и в начале каждой строки будет inod номер — индивидуальный номер для каждого файла, который существует в сиситеме.)
введите команду find -inum ******* -exec rm -i <> \; — где вместо*******должен стоять inod номер файла который не удаляется
have a lot of fan. Удачи!
Большое спасибо всем кто откликнулся на проблему.

Источник

Не получается удалить файл — операция не позволена

Дистр/система-то какая? В BSD есть «супер» флаг у файлов.

gatsu% su Пароль: [root@gatsu gatsu]# rm -f /usr/bin/steam rm: невозможно удалить «/usr/bin/steam»: Операция не позволена 

ps: может папка bin только для чтения?

Читайте также:  Чистка manjaro linux от мусора

Проверил на соседнем бинарнике — нормально удалился.

gatsu ★ ( 22.02.13 20:43:11 MSK )
Последнее исправление: gatsu 22.02.13 20:43:41 MSK (всего исправлений: 1)

Стим запущен? Может flock делает на файле или типо того?

//me не специалист, просто предполагаю

killall steam rm -f /usr/bin/steam 

Пакет изначально устаналивался из AUR:

[2012-12-09 15:29] Running 'pacman -U steam-1.0.0.16-4-i686.pkg.tar.xz' [2012-12-09 15:29] chattr: Нет такого файла или каталога while trying to stat /usr/bin/steam [2012-12-09 15:29] YOU NEED ONE OF THE OPT DEPENDS [2012-12-09 15:29] you don't need gksu or xterm [2012-12-09 15:29] infact until they release the new version of steam [2012-12-09 15:29] it probably better to remove them [2012-12-09 15:29] installed steam (1.0.0.16-4) [2012-12-09 15:31] Running 'pacman -U steam-1.0.0.16-4-i686.pkg.tar.xz' [2012-12-09 15:31] YOU NEED ONE OF THE OPT DEPENDS [2012-12-09 15:31] you don't need gksu or xterm [2012-12-09 15:31] infact until they release the new version of steam [2012-12-09 15:31] it probably better to remove them [2012-12-09 15:31] upgraded steam (1.0.0.16-4 -> 1.0.0.16-4) 

Потом приплыло обновление из комьюнити-репозитория:

[2013-02-12 18:22] Running 'pacman -Syu' . [2013-02-12 18:49] error: cannot remove /usr/bin/steam (Операция не позволена) [2013-02-12 18:49] if you are running x86_64, you need the lib32 opt depends for your driver [2013-02-12 18:49] [2013-02-12 18:49] if you are having problems with the steam license, remove .steam and .local/share/Steam [2013-02-12 18:49] upgraded steam (1.0.0.16-4 -> 1.0.0.25-3) 
[2013-02-17 15:50] Running 'pacman -Syu' . [2013-02-17 16:41] error: cannot remove /usr/bin/steam (Операция не позволена) [2013-02-17 16:41] if you are running x86_64, you need the lib32 opt depends for your driver [2013-02-17 16:41] [2013-02-17 16:41] if you are having problems with the steam license, remove .steam and .local/share/Steam [2013-02-17 16:41] upgraded steam (1.0.0.25-3 -> 1.0.0.28-2) 

После чего я снёс проблемный пакет, а файл так и остался.

gatsu ★ ( 22.02.13 20:54:20 MSK )
Последнее исправление: gatsu 22.02.13 20:57:11 MSK (всего исправлений: 2)

Источник

Оцените статью
Adblock
detector